October is Domestic Abuse Awareness Month — and the Centre Against Abuse has embarked on a promotional campaign to raise awareness of the social ill.

Among other activities, the Centre is placing posters at locations across the island including the King Edward VII Memorial Hospital, MarketPlace stores in Shelly Bay, Hamilton, Heron Bay and Somerset and at Lindo’s in Devonshire.

The Centre also had a showcase set up on a stage at PrimaDiva at 75 Reid Street, across from Chop Sticks, showing a family in chains symbolising  the abusive dynamics at play in the household.

The showcase was on display until October 8.

The Centre Against Abuse is a charity aimed at eradicating abusive relationships in Bermuda.

Its mission is to provide shelter, support and tools for those involved in abusive relationships; and to create advocates for an abuse-free Bermuda community through education and prevention.

The Centre says while no one is exempt from abuse, women aged between 20 and 24 are at the greatest risk of non-fatal intimate partner violence and highest rates of rape and sexual assault.
